Mounjaro vs Wegovy for Leeds Patients
| Factor | Mounjaro (tirzepatide) | Wegovy (semaglutide) |
|---|---|---|
| Average weight loss | 22.5% (15mg, SURMOUNT-1) | 14.9–20.7% (STEP 1 / STEP UP) |
| Mechanism | Dual GLP-1 + GIP agonist | GLP-1 agonist only |
| Cardiovascular benefit label | Not yet — SURPASS-CVOT pending | ✅ NICE approved April 2026 (BMI 27+ with CVD, no T2D) |
| Slinic starting price | £139.00/pen | £99.99/pen |
| Oral option | Not yet available | ✅ Wegovy pill — MHRA approved 11 June 2026 |
| NHS availability (Leeds) | Via tier 3 (12–18 months (varies by district)) | Via tier 3 (12–18 months (varies by district)) or GP cardiovascular pathway |
| Head-to-head trial (SURMOUNT-5) | 20.2% weight loss | 13.7% weight loss |

Mounjaro Results: What West Yorkshire Patients Can Realistically Expect
The SURMOUNT-1 trial provides the most rigorous data available. Here is what the results look like for a typical Leeds or West Yorkshire patient, translated from percentages into real weight figures:
| Timepoint | Average % loss (15mg) | Real weight (95kg patient) | What patients typically notice |
|---|---|---|---|
| Week 4 (Month 1) | ~3–4% | ~2.9–3.8 kg | Appetite noticeably quieter. Portions reducing naturally. Scale starting to move. Side effects typically mild at 2.5mg. |
| Week 12 (Month 3) | ~8–9% | ~7.6–8.6 kg | Clothes fitting significantly differently. Energy improving. Joints and mobility often the first health benefits noticed alongside weight loss. |
| Week 24 (Month 6) | ~14–15% | ~13.3–14.3 kg | Major physical transformation. Blood pressure, blood sugar, and lipids typically improved. Physical activity much easier — important for West Yorkshire’s active outdoor culture. |
| Week 52 (Month 12) | ~20–21% | ~19–20 kg | Substantial health transformation. Many patients at this stage have been able to reduce or stop other medications under GP guidance. |
| Week 72 (Month 18) | 22.5% | ~21.4 kg | Full SURMOUNT-1 endpoint. 57% of 15mg patients achieved 20%+ weight loss. Rate slows in months 12–18 — completely normal, not a sign of treatment failure. |

Bradford and West Yorkshire South Asian community: Why BMI adjustments matter
Bradford has one of the largest South Asian communities in the UK — with a population that is approximately 24% Pakistani and Bangladeshi, plus significant Indian communities. This has direct implications for Mounjaro prescribing:
- South Asians develop type 2 diabetes at BMI levels 5–7 kg/m² lower than white European populations — a BMI of 23 in a South Asian patient carries equivalent metabolic risk to a BMI of 28–30 in a white European patient
- Cardiovascular risk, insulin resistance, and fatty liver disease all manifest at lower BMI in South Asian populations
- NHS England and NICE both endorse lower BMI thresholds: BMI 23+ with a qualifying condition, or BMI 27.5+ without a condition
- At Slinic, these adjustments are applied automatically — a Bradford patient of Pakistani background with BMI 24 and type 2 diabetes qualifies for Mounjaro under adjusted criteria

Mounjaro Side Effects: What Leeds Patients Should Know
| Side effect | Rate at 15mg (SURMOUNT-1) | When | What to do |
|---|---|---|---|
| Nausea | ~32% | First 2–4 weeks at each new dose | Eat smaller meals, eat slowly, avoid high-fat foods. Contact Slinic if severe or persistent — antiemetics can be prescribed. |
| Diarrhoea | ~23% | First 2–4 weeks at each dose | Reduce high-fibre foods temporarily. Increase hydration. Seek review if severe or prolonged. |
| Constipation | ~17% | Variable onset | Increase fluid and dietary fibre. Macrogol sachets if needed. Raise at next monthly check-in. |
| Vomiting | ~11% | First 2–4 weeks at each dose | Dietary modification. Contact Slinic urgently if unable to keep fluids down for 24+ hours. |
| Hair thinning | Common with any rapid weight loss | Months 3–6 | Increase protein intake to 1.2–1.6g/kg target body weight. Check ferritin levels. Do not stop medication — resolves naturally. |
| Fatigue | Common early in treatment | First few weeks at new doses | Review calorie and protein intake. Most cases are nutritional rather than a direct drug effect. |
Mounjaro for Leeds Patients with Type 2 Diabetes
West Yorkshire has elevated rates of type 2 diabetes — particularly in Bradford where South Asian community prevalence of T2D is 3–6 times higher than white European populations at equivalent BMI. For Leeds and Bradford patients with T2D:
- Dual licence — Mounjaro is uniquely licensed for both weight management and type 2 diabetes in the UK
- Blood sugar control — SURPASS-2 trial showed 15mg Mounjaro reduced HbA1c by an average of 2.58% — transformative for many T2D patients
- QOF direct prescribing — from April 2026, some West Yorkshire GP practices can prescribe Mounjaro directly for T2D without the tier 3 weight management wait. Ask your GP whether their practice participates in the new QOF obesity indicators
- Medication coordination — as blood sugar improves with Mounjaro, insulin and sulphonylurea doses typically need reducing. Coordinate closely with your GP or Bradford/Leeds diabetes team throughout

Cold-chain packaging maintains 2–8°C throughout transit regardless of outside temperature. Mounjaro pens must be stored in a refrigerator before first use. After opening, they can be kept at room temperature below 30°C for up to 21 days — in West Yorkshire’s cooler climate this is rarely a concern, but refrigerator storage is always the safest option.
